a detailed update

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"a detailed update"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when referring to a comprehensive or thorough report or information about a particular subject or situation. Example: "I would appreciate a detailed update on the project's progress by the end of the week."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

Use "a detailed update" when you want to convey that the information provided is thorough, comprehensive, and includes specific details. It's suitable for formal reports, project summaries, or any situation where precision is important.

Common error

Avoid using "a detailed update" when the information lacks actual depth or specific facts. Ensure the update truly provides substantial information; otherwise, opt for a more general term like "update" or "report".

FAQs

How can I use "a detailed update" in a sentence?

You can use "a detailed update" to describe a thorough report or briefing. For example, "The manager provided "a detailed update" on the project's progress".

What can I say instead of "a detailed update"?

Alternatives include "a comprehensive report", "an exhaustive account", or "a thorough rundown", depending on the context.

What makes an update "detailed"?

A "detailed" update includes specific facts, figures, and explanations. It goes beyond a general overview to provide a thorough understanding of the subject.

When is it appropriate to ask for "a detailed update"?

It's appropriate to request "a detailed update" when you require a comprehensive understanding of a situation or project, especially when important decisions depend on the information.
